HEALTHCARE

Making quality healthcare affordable and accessible has been the objective of the Trust ever since its inception. The Trust has initiated several activities that benefit the rural and urban poor. Apart from organizing health camps and health awareness programmes, the Trust also distributes medicines to economically weaker sections of the society.

Medical Camp

Medical camps especially for people in rural areas are organized by the Trust. Specialists from recognized hospitals carry out various diagnostic tests free of cost. Medicines are also distributed free.

Medical Awareness programme

The Trust organizes Anemia awareness programmes and general health check-up especially for women.

Medical Aid for under-privileged people

The Trust sponsors medical expenses for critical illness and surgeries for a number of under-privileged persons. It has spread its donation of medicines to aged and poor patients suffering from cancer, leprosy, defects of the heart/ kidney, mental illness and other major disorders.

Blood donation camps

The Trust conducts blood donation camps, wherein a number of people voluntarily come forward to donate blood. The blood collected at these camps are being given to poor people at free of cost through hospitals like JIPMER.

 
Initiatives
2008-2009
Medical Awareness Programme - The Trust sponsored an Anemia Awareness Programme for women. Over 490 women benefited from this programme. The results were shared by Dr. Umashankar (Retd). of JIPMER Hospital. It was found that most of the women were suffering from Anemia. Counseling was given by the doctor about healthy eating habits to improve the Hemoglobin count in the blood.

Blood Donation Camp - Sriram Charitable Trust and Integra Software Services Pvt. Ltd conducted a Blood Donation Camp in collaboration with JIPMER Hospital, Pondicherry. Around 100 employees of Integra participated in the camp and donated Blood. The team from JIPMER headed by Dr.Subbiah who is in-charge of the blood bank of JIPMER collected blood from the donors in a safe & hygiene manner. The blood collected during the camp was deposited in the blood bank of JIPMER and supplied to poor patients free of cost.
